odihni
to rest /o.dihˈni/
verb#3319 most common
Also: to relax, to rest oneself
Example sentences
Copilul se odihnește după joacă.
The child rests after playing.
Ne odihnim puțin după prânz.
We rest a little after lunch.
Bunica s-a odihnit toată după-amiaza.
Grandma rested all afternoon.
Mâine mă voi odihni acasă, pentru că sunt foarte obosit.
Tomorrow I will rest at home, because I am very tired.
Doctorul i-a recomandat pacientului să se odihnească mai mult înainte de operație.
The doctor recommended that the patient rest more before the surgery.
Ostenit de drumul lung, călătorul se odihni sub un stejar bătrân, ascultând foșnetul frunzelor.
Tired from the long road, the traveler rested under an old oak tree, listening to the rustle of the leaves.
Conjugation
| Present Active | Simple Past Active | Simple Future Active | |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1sg | mă odihnesc | mă odihnii | mă voi odihni |
| 2sg | te odihnești | te odihniși | te vei odihni |
| 3sg | se odihnește | se odihni | se va odihni |
| 1pl | ne odihnim | ne odihnirăm | ne vom odihni |
| 2pl | vă odihniți | vă odihnirăți | vă veți odihni |
| 3pl | se odihnesc | se odihniră | se vor odihni |

Etymology
The word traces to Old Church Slavonic, entering Romanian along with many everyday terms during centuries of contact with Slavic-speaking neighbors. The root is tied to a Slavic word for breathing, so the original sense was closer to catching one's breath than to leisure. Romanian kept both the noun "odihnă" (rest) and the verb "a odihni" (to rest) from this same borrowing.
